当前位置: 首页>>代码示例>>C#>>正文


C# ViewModel.GetImage方法代码示例

本文整理汇总了C#中ViewModel.GetImage方法的典型用法代码示例。如果您正苦于以下问题:C# ViewModel.GetImage方法的具体用法?C# ViewModel.GetImage怎么用?C# ViewModel.GetImage使用的例子?那么,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在ViewModel的用法示例。


在下文中一共展示了ViewModel.GetImage方法的12个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的C#代码示例。

示例1: InitOnce

        public void InitOnce(TableLayoutPanel grid, ViewModel viewModel)
        {
            _Grid = grid;
            _Style = new RowStyle(SizeType.Absolute, 27F);

            Dock = DockStyle.Fill;

            _Label = new Label();
            _Label.TextAlign = ContentAlignment.MiddleRight;
            _Label.Dock = DockStyle.Fill;

            TbData.GotFocus += new EventHandler(TbData_GotFocus);

            BtView.Image = viewModel.GetImage("att-file-preview");
            _Body.ShowTips(BtView, "查看文件");
            BtOpen.Image = viewModel.GetImage("att-file-append");
            _Body.ShowTips(BtOpen, "添加文件");

            //BtFill.Image = viewModel.GetImage("att-copy");
            //_Body.ShowTips(BtFill, "复制");
            BtCopy.Image = viewModel.GetImage("script-fill-16");
            _Body.ShowTips(BtCopy, "填充");

            InitSpec(TbData);
        }
开发者ID:burstas,项目名称:rmps,代码行数:25,代码来源:UcFileAtt.cs

示例2: InitOnce

        public void InitOnce(TableLayoutPanel grid, ViewModel viewModel)
        {
            _Grid = grid;
            _Style = new RowStyle(SizeType.Absolute, 27F);

            Dock = DockStyle.Fill;

            _Label = new Label();
            _Label.TextAlign = ContentAlignment.MiddleRight;
            _Label.Dock = DockStyle.Fill;

            TbData.GotFocus += new EventHandler(TbData_GotFocus);

            BtFill.Image = viewModel.GetImage("att-data-options");
            _Body.ShowTips(BtFill, "选项");
            BtCopy.Image = viewModel.GetImage("att-copy");
            _Body.ShowTips(BtCopy, "复制");
            BtFill.Image = viewModel.GetImage("script-fill-16");
            _Body.ShowTips(BtFill, "填充");
        }
开发者ID:burstas,项目名称:rmps,代码行数:20,代码来源:AttData.cs

示例3: InitOnce

        public void InitOnce(TableLayoutPanel grid, ViewModel viewModel)
        {
            _Grid = grid;
            _ViewModel = viewModel;
            _Style = new RowStyle(SizeType.Absolute, 27F);

            Dock = DockStyle.Fill;

            _Label = new Label();
            _Label.TextAlign = ContentAlignment.MiddleRight;
            _Label.Dock = DockStyle.Fill;

            TbData.GotFocus += new EventHandler(TbData_GotFocus);

            BtMod.Image = viewModel.GetImage(TbData.UseSystemPasswordChar ? "att-pass-hide" : "att-pass-show");
            _Body.ShowTips(BtMod, TbData.UseSystemPasswordChar ? "显示口令" : "隐藏口令");
            BtCopy.Image = viewModel.GetImage("att-copy");
            _Body.ShowTips(BtCopy, "复制");
            BtFill.Image = viewModel.GetImage("script-fill-16");
            _Body.ShowTips(BtFill, "填充");
        }
开发者ID:burstas,项目名称:rmps,代码行数:21,代码来源:AttPass.cs

示例4: Init

        public void Init(WPwd wPwd, UserModel userModel, SafeModel safeModel, DataModel dataModel, ViewModel viewModel)
        {
            _WPwd = wPwd;
            _UserModel = userModel;
            _SafeModel = safeModel;
            _DataModel = dataModel;
            _ViewModel = viewModel;
            _LastIndex = -1;

            _DataList = new DataTable();
            _DataList.Columns.Add("Order", typeof(string));
            _DataList.Columns.Add("Name", typeof(Att));
            OrderCol.DataPropertyName = "Order";
            ValueCol.DataPropertyName = "Name";
            GvAttList.AutoGenerateColumns = false;
            GvAttList.DataSource = _DataList;

            _CmpList = new Dictionary<int, IAttEditer>(Att.TYPE_SIZE + 2);

            BtFill.Image = _ViewModel.GetImage("script-fill-16");
            _WPwd.ShowTips(BtFill, "填充");

            BtSave.Image = _ViewModel.GetImage("att-save");
            _WPwd.ShowTips(BtSave, "保存属性");

            BtDrop.Image = _ViewModel.GetImage("att-drop");
            _WPwd.ShowTips(BtDrop, "移除属性");
        }
开发者ID:burstas,项目名称:rmps,代码行数:28,代码来源:WPro.cs

示例5: InitOnce

        public void InitOnce(DataModel dataModel, ViewModel viewModel)
        {
            this.TbText.GotFocus += new EventHandler(TbName_GotFocus);
            this.DtData.GotFocus += new EventHandler(DtData_GotFocus);

            BtNow.Image = viewModel.GetImage("att-date-now");
            _APro.ShowTips(BtNow, "当前时间");
            BtOpt.Image = viewModel.GetImage("att-date-options");
            _APro.ShowTips(BtOpt, "选项");

            InitSpec(DtData);
        }
开发者ID:burstas,项目名称:rmps,代码行数:12,代码来源:UcDateAtt.cs

示例6: InitOnce

        public void InitOnce(DataModel dataModel, ViewModel viewModel)
        {
            _DataModel = dataModel;

            BtOpt.Visible = false;

            TbText.GotFocus += new EventHandler(TbText_GotFocus);
            TbData.GotFocus += new EventHandler(TbData_GotFocus);

            BtOpt.Image = viewModel.GetImage("att-call-options");
            _APro.ShowTips(BtOpt, "选项");

            InitSpec(TbData);
        }
开发者ID:burstas,项目名称:rmps,代码行数:14,代码来源:UcCallAtt.cs

示例7: InitOnce

        public void InitOnce(DataModel dataModel, ViewModel viewModel)
        {
            _DataModel = dataModel;
            _ViewModel = viewModel;

            TbText.GotFocus += new EventHandler(TbText_GotFocus);
            TbData.GotFocus += new EventHandler(TbData_GotFocus);

            BtMod.Image = viewModel.GetImage(TbData.UseSystemPasswordChar ? "att-pass-hide" : "att-pass-show");
            _APro.ShowTips(BtMod, TbData.UseSystemPasswordChar ? "显示口令" : "隐藏口令");
            BtGen.Image = viewModel.GetImage("att-pass-gen");
            _APro.ShowTips(BtGen, "生成随机口令");
            BtOpt.Image = viewModel.GetImage("att-pass-options");
            _APro.ShowTips(BtOpt, "选项");

            CmMenu.SuspendLayout();
            _CharLenDef = new ToolStripMenuItem();
            _CharLenDef.Size = new System.Drawing.Size(160, 22);
            _CharLenDef.Text = "默认(&D)";
            _CharLenDef.Click += new EventHandler(MiCharLenDef_Click);
            MuCharLen.DropDownItems.Add(_CharLenDef);

            _CharLenSep = new ToolStripSeparator();
            MuCharLen.DropDownItems.Add(_CharLenSep);

            InitMenu("6", "6", MuCharLen);
            InitMenu("8", "8", MuCharLen);
            InitMenu("10", "10", MuCharLen);
            InitMenu("12", "12", MuCharLen);
            InitMenu("14", "14", MuCharLen);
            InitMenu("16", "16", MuCharLen);

            _CharLenDiy = new ToolStripMenuItem();
            _CharLenDiy.Size = new System.Drawing.Size(160, 22);
            _CharLenDiy.Text = "其它…(&O)";
            _CharLenDiy.Click += new EventHandler(MiCharLenDiy_Click);

            _LastCharLen = _CharLenDef;
            _LastCharLen.Checked = true;

            CmMenu.ResumeLayout(true);

            _CharSetDef = new ToolStripMenuItem();
            _CharSetDef.Size = new System.Drawing.Size(160, 22);
            _CharSetDef.Text = "默认(&D)";
            _CharSetDef.Click += new EventHandler(MiCharSetDef_Click);

            _CharSetSep = new ToolStripSeparator();
        }
开发者ID:burstas,项目名称:rmps,代码行数:49,代码来源:UcPassAtt.cs

示例8: InitOnce

        public void InitOnce(DataModel dataModel, ViewModel viewModel)
        {
            _DataModel = dataModel;

            TbText.GotFocus += new EventHandler(TbName_GotFocus);
            TbData.GotFocus += new EventHandler(TbData_GotFocus);

            BtView.Image = viewModel.GetImage("att-file-preview");
            _APro.ShowTips(BtView, "查看文件");
            BtOpen.Image = viewModel.GetImage("att-file-append");
            _APro.ShowTips(BtOpen, "添加文件");

            InitSpec(TbData);
        }
开发者ID:burstas,项目名称:rmps,代码行数:14,代码来源:UcFileAtt.cs

示例9: InitOnce

        public void InitOnce(DataModel dataModel, ViewModel viewModel)
        {
            TbText.GotFocus += new EventHandler(TText_GotFocus);
            TbData.GotFocus += new EventHandler(TbData_GotFocus);

            BtOpen.Image = viewModel.GetImage("att-link-open");
            _APro.ShowTips(BtOpen, "打开链接");

            InitSpec(TbData);
        }
开发者ID:burstas,项目名称:rmps,代码行数:10,代码来源:UcLinkAtt.cs

示例10: InitOnce

        public void InitOnce(DataModel dataModel, ViewModel viewModel)
        {
            this.TbText.GotFocus += new EventHandler(TbText_GotFocus);
            this.TbData.GotFocus += new EventHandler(TbData_GotFocus);

            BtOpt.Image = viewModel.GetImage("att-data-options");
            _APro.ShowTips(BtOpt, "选项");

            InitSpec(TbData);
        }
开发者ID:burstas,项目名称:rmps,代码行数:10,代码来源:UcDataAtt.cs

示例11: InitOnce

        public void InitOnce(DataModel dataModel, ViewModel viewModel)
        {
            TbText.GotFocus += new EventHandler(TbText_GotFocus);
            TbData.GotFocus += new EventHandler(TbData_GotFocus);

            BtSend.Image = viewModel.GetImage("att-mail-send");
            _APro.ShowTips(BtSend, "撰写邮件");

            InitSpec(TbData);
        }
开发者ID:burstas,项目名称:rmps,代码行数:10,代码来源:UcMailAtt.cs

示例12: Init

        public void Init(DataModel dataModel, ViewModel viewModel)
        {
            _DataModel = dataModel;

            PbFill.Image = viewModel.GetImage("script-fill-24");
            _AWiz.ShowTips(PbFill, "执行填充脚本");
            PbCard.Image = viewModel.GetImage("export-card-24");
            _AWiz.ShowTips(PbCard, "导出为卡片");

            string path = Path.Combine(_UserModel.SysHome, "Card");
            if (!Directory.Exists(path))
            {
                return;
            }

            EventHandler exportHandler = new EventHandler(ExportCard_Click);

            XmlDocument doc = new XmlDocument();
            ToolStripMenuItem item;
            XmlNode node;
            foreach (string cardFile in Directory.GetFiles(path, "*.acxml"))
            {
                try
                {
                    doc.Load(cardFile);

                    node = doc.SelectSingleNode("/amon/info/name");
                    string name = (node != null ? node.InnerText ?? "未知" : Path.GetFileName(cardFile));
                    node = doc.SelectSingleNode("/amon/info/type");
                    string type = (node != null ? node.InnerText ?? "" : "all").Trim().ToLower();

                    item = new ToolStripMenuItem();
                    item.Text = name;

                    if ("htm" == type)
                    {
                        item.Tag = "htm:" + cardFile;
                        item.Click += exportHandler;
                        CcHtm.DropDownItems.Add(item);
                        continue;
                    }
                    if ("svg" == type)
                    {
                        item.Tag = "svg:" + cardFile;
                        item.Click += exportHandler;
                        CcHtm.DropDownItems.Add(item);
                        continue;
                    }
                    if ("txt" == type)
                    {
                        item.Tag = "txt:" + cardFile;
                        item.Click += exportHandler;
                        CcTxt.DropDownItems.Add(item);
                        continue;
                    }
                    if ("vcf" == type)
                    {
                        item.Tag = "vcf:" + cardFile;
                        item.Click += exportHandler;
                        CcTxt.DropDownItems.Add(item);
                        continue;
                    }
                    if ("png" == type)
                    {
                        item.Tag = "png:" + cardFile;
                        item.Click += exportHandler;
                        CcImg.DropDownItems.Add(item);
                        continue;
                    }
                    if ("qrc" == type)
                    {
                        item.Tag = "qrc:" + cardFile;
                        item.Click += exportHandler;
                        CcImg.DropDownItems.Add(item);
                        continue;
                    }
                    item.Tag = "all:" + cardFile;
                    item.Click += exportHandler;
                    CcAll.DropDownItems.Add(item);
                }
                catch (Exception exp)
                {
                    Main.ShowError(exp);
                    return;
                }
            }
        }
开发者ID:burstas,项目名称:rmps,代码行数:87,代码来源:KeyGuid.cs


注:本文中的ViewModel.GetImage方法示例由纯净天空整理自Github/MSDocs等开源代码及文档管理平台,相关代码片段筛选自各路编程大神贡献的开源项目,源码版权归原作者所有,传播和使用请参考对应项目的License;未经允许,请勿转载。